Youngstown is the county seat of the Mahoning Valley in northeast Ohio, just 10 miles from the Pennsylvania border. Located midway between New York City and Chicago along Interstate 80, this Rust Belt city of more than 65,000 residents is known for being affordable and family-friendly.

Did You Know?

  • The first Arby’s restaurant opened in nearby Boardman, OH in July 1964
  • Notable Youngstown natives include actor Ed O’Neill (“Married with Children,” “Modern Family”), football coach Bob Stoops and former boxing champion Ray Mancini
  • Bruce Springsteen composed the song “Youngstown” for his 1995 album The Ghost of Tom Joad and performed it the following year at Youngstown’s Stambaugh Theatre

Enjoy the Best of the Valley

There are plenty of leisure activities to enjoy in and around Youngstown. Before you head out, make time for these local attractions:

The Canfield Fair

The largest county fair in Ohio has celebrated the area’s rural roots for nearly 175 years. Artists and entertainers who have performed there include Johnny Cash, Bob Hope, Kenny Rogers, The Beach Boys, Willie Nelson and The Band Perry.

Mill Creek MetroParks

Outdoors enthusiasts can enjoy 4,400 acres of lakes, hiking and biking trails, golf courses, historic sites and more available throughout the area. Lanterman’s Mill, one of the county’s leading historic landmarks, was built in the mid-1800s and still operates today, grinding corn, wheat and buckwheat in traditional fashion.

Old-Fashioned Christmas in the Woods

This October festival, considered one of the country’s top arts and crafts shows, draws thousands of visitors each year to a backdrop of scenic woods and fall colors. The event features more than 200 vendors and exhibitors, live entertainment and, of course, delicious food.

Butler Museum of American Art

The first museum dedicated to American Art, the Institute holds more than 22,000 individual works from thousands of American artists. The earliest piece is a portrait from 1719!

Take in a Game … or Several

Football in Ohio is a serious pursuit and at Youngstown State University, the Penguins are a perennial NCAA power. Hockey fans can go see the Youngstown Phantoms, a top junior team, and the Mahoning Valley Scrappers are a minor league affiliate of Major League Baseball’s Cleveland Indians.
